In a recent heated debate between Florida Governor Ron DeSantis and California Governor Gavin Newsom, an unexpected prop took center stage.

The debate, which aired on Fox News, saw the two governors clashing over various issues, including the Covid-19 pandemic, the 2024 presidential race, and LGBT+ rights. However, it was DeSantis's unusual use of a "poop map" of San Francisco that left viewers both puzzled and amused.

The incident occurred when Newsom criticized Florida's mental health resources, which he claimed were severely lacking compared to California's. "Ron has literally the worst mental health system in America, forgive me, outside of Mississippi and Texas. And so, with all due respect of being lectured on some of these topics, Ron DeSantis is not the one Im going to be listening to," Newsom stated.

In response, DeSantis reached into his suit jacket and produced a map of San Francisco, marked with brown spots. "This is a map of San Francisco," DeSantis said, presenting the map to the audience. "Theres a lot of plots on that. You may be asking: What is that plotting? Well, this is an app where they plot the human faeces that are found on the streets of San Francisco."

DeSantis went on to explain that the extensive coverage of brown markings on the map was indicative of the city's decline. "And you see how almost the whole thing is covered? Because this is what has happened in one of the previous greatest cities this country has ever had," he said.

Newsom could only laugh as DeSantis continued his argument, linking the issue of human waste on the streets to the recent visit of Chinese President Xi Jinping. DeSantis claimed that the city had cleaned up the streets for the communist leader's visit, but failed to do the same for its own residents.

The unusual display left social media users bewildered, with many making light of DeSantis's choice of prop. "Ron DeSantis just held up a poop map of San Francisco to show where people are tagging feces from homeless people on all the public streets. Holy s***. Literally," one user wrote.

Despite the mockery, former Trump press secretary and current Fox News host Kayleigh McEnany praised DeSantis's move, calling it "another strong and powerful moment" for the Republican governor.

The map DeSantis used was a graphic released in 2019 by OpenTheBooks.com, which plotted reports of human faeces across San Francisco from 2011 to 2019. The map featured over 75,000 points, each representing a reported sighting of human waste.

OpenTheBooks.com founder and CEO Adam Andrzejewski expressed pride in seeing his map used in the debate. "It was a cultural moment in 2019, and obviously it was a moment again this evening," he said.
